Step 2: Water Removal

We use specialized equipment to extract water from your property, including our powerful pumps and wet/dry vacuums. Our team works efficiently to remove standing water and prevent further damage. We also use moisture-detecting equipment to identify hidden moisture and ensure that your property is completely dry.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our team sets up drying equipment to remove excess moisture from your property. We use high-velocity fans and dehumidifiers to speed up the drying process. Our technicians monitor the drying process closely to ensure that your property is completely dry and safe.

Common Questions About Frozen Pipe Water Removal

Q: What causes frozen pipes?

Frozen pipes are caused by water freezing in the pipes, usually due to extreme cold temperatures. This can happen when pipes are not properly insulated or are located in unheated areas.
